Setting the Stage: Betting & Difficulty

Before each round you set a stake ranging from a modest €0.01 up to €150—though most casual players opt for the lower end to keep risk manageable during quick play.

The difficulty ladder offers four options:

  • Easy – 24 steps, low risk, modest multipliers.
  • Medium – 22 steps, balanced risk/reward.
  • Hard – 20 steps, higher potential.
  • Hardcore – 15 steps, maximum risk with a steep chance of loss at each step.

Choosing a level is about matching your confidence with the time you have left in your session. A player who wants frequent small wins will linger on Easy, while someone chasing big payouts might test Hard or Hardcore after a few successful rounds.

Bankroll Management in Fast Sessions

Even when playing in short bursts, bankroll discipline cannot be ignored. A simple rule many quick‑play players follow is “bet no more than 1–3% of your total bankroll per round.” This keeps your fund from draining during unlucky streaks.

If you’re aiming for higher payouts on Hard or Hardcore modes, consider setting a separate micro‑budget just for those experiments—like €5 or €10—and keep the rest reserved for safer Easy rounds.

You can also use a “stop‑loss” threshold: stop playing once your bankroll dips below a certain amount or after a predetermined number of consecutive losses.
